Our Mission

“Empowering Hazara and Afghan-Australian youth through leadership, culture, and community , so every young person can thrive and lead with pride.”

Youth Empowerment

Equipping young Hazara-Australians with the skills, confidence, and networks to lead.

Cultural Pride

Celebrating and preserving Hazara heritage through events, art, and community connection.

Advocacy & Justice

Standing as a voice for the Hazara community on the world stage.
